Identifying Window Treatment Hazards for Children
Before exploring child-safe window treatment options, it's essential to identify the potential hazards present in traditional window coverings. The primary concern with conventional window treatments is the use of cords and chains. These elements pose a significant entanglement and strangulation risk to young children. To create a safe environment, it's crucial to select window treatments that eliminate or minimize such hazards.
Cordless Window Treatment Options
Cordless window treatments provide an excellent solution for parents looking to prioritize safety without compromising on style and functionality. There are numerous cordless options available that cater to various aesthetics while ensuring a risk-free environment for your children. Let's explore the most popular cordless window treatments suitable for families with young children:
1. Cordless Roller Shades: Featuring a smooth and streamlined design, cordless roller shades look sleek in any room. They operate with a spring mechanism, allowing you to raise and lower the shade with just a gentle pull.
2. Cordless Cellular Shades: As an energy-efficient choice, cordless cellular shades come in a variety of colors and opacity levels. They consist of a honeycomb structure that provides excellent insulation and can be easily adjusted by grasping the bottom rail.
3. Cordless Roman Shades: Combining elegance and safety, cordless Roman shades boast a sophisticated appearance with their cascading folds. They also function via a discreet pull handle or bottom rail, ensuring a child-safe environment.
Motorized Window Treatment Solutions
Motorized window treatments are another excellent option for child-safe spaces. With the convenience of remote control operation, motorized shades and blinds offer efficient and hassle-free light control without the need for cords. Here are some popular motorized window treatment options:
1. Motorized Roller Shades: With their clean lines and modern appearance, motorized roller shades can complement any décor. Operating the shades is as simple as pressing a button on the remote, easily adjusting the level of natural light in your home.
2. Motorized Cellular Shades: Offering a perfect blend of energy efficiency and child safety, motorized cellular shades are managed via remote control. This allows for effortless adjustment to control the level of light and privacy.
3. Motorized Draperies: For a more luxurious option, motorized draperies provide an opulent aesthetic, along with the added convenience of remote control operation.
Retrofitting Traditional Window Treatments for Safety
If you're not ready to replace your existing window treatments entirely, there are some retrofitting options available to make them safer for children. Here are some suggestions for enhancing safety without replacing your window treatments:
1. Cord Cleats: Installing cord cleats on your walls allows you to secure loose cords up and out of the reach of children.
2. Breakaway Cord Condensers: These safety devices are designed to further reduce the risk of entanglement. They function by separating the cords when a specific amount of force is applied.
3. Cordless Retrofit Kits: Some manufacturers offer retrofit kits to convert corded window treatments into cordless ones, allowing for enhanced safety without the need for new window coverings.
